Does insurance cover IT Band Syndrome treatment in Illinois?
Most major insurance plans cover medically necessary treatment for IT Band Syndrome, including consultations, imaging, physical therapy, and surgery. Coverage details vary by plan. Contact your insurer or the provider's office to verify coverage before scheduling.
What type of doctor treats IT Band Syndrome?
IT Band Syndrome is typically treated by an orthopaedic surgeon. Depending on the specific condition, you may see a specialist in sports medicine, joint replacement, spine surgery, or another orthopaedic sub-specialty.
